GWRGreat Western Railway HawksworthFrederick Hawksworth, Chief Mechanical Engineer (CME) of the Great Western Railway 1941-1948 Corridor Third (TK) No 2119 was built for BRBritish Rail or British Railways in 1949 by the Gloucester Carriage and Wagon Works. It had an oak interior rather than the more usual mahogany.

It was purchased in 1968 from Didcot, and has seen many years of use on the SVRSevern Valley Railway. However as of May 2015 it is stored alongside Kidderminster Carriage Shed awaiting an overhaul. It is owned by The Great Western (SVR) Association.
